Jim Salinger is a scholar working on Atmospheric Science, Global and Planetary Change and Ecology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Jim Salinger has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 416 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Atmospheric Science, 6 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 4 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Jim Salinger’s work include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(4 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(4 papers) and Climate variability and models (3 papers). Jim Salinger is often cited by papers focused on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(4 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(4 papers) and Climate variability and models (3 papers). Jim Salinger collaborates with scholars based in New Zealand, United States and Australia. Jim Salinger's co-authors include Anthony M. Fowler, Gerard M. Wellington, Stephen S. Howe, Jonathan Palmer and Braddock K. Linsley and has published in prestigious journals such as Climatic Change, Agricultural and Forest Meteorology and Palaeogeography Palaeoclimatology Palaeoecology.
